Make a colorful jellyfish.
Enhance an ocean theme by making these jazzy jellyfish! Not only will they go along with an ocean or beach theme but also with the

First, cut out a circle of clear Con-Tact covering for each child. Make it a fairly large circle. 2. Then peel off the backing to reveal the sticky side. Invite a child to paint with the colors of her choice in the center of the sticky circle, leaving an unpainted edge all around. 3. Next you are going to fold the circle over into a semi-circle. But before you do that place some crepe paper "tentacles" on the edge of one half of the circle. Then fold over the paper to create a semicircle, and press the edges together to seal in the paint. You want to catch the streamers inside the circle. 4. Punch two holes in the top and tie a piece of yarn to hang your creation up.
